NAZA – PSA Group ASEAN Manufacturing Hub Gets A New Boss

Laurence Noël has been appointed as the new CEO of the Naza Automotive Manufacturing (NAM) joint venture, and Senior Vice President of ASEAN markets, effective 1st May 2018.

The NAM joint venture, inked in February of this year, establishes a shared operation between PSA Group (owners of Peugeot, Citroen, and DS Automobiles), and NAZA to operate the Group’s first ASEAN manufacturing hub, in Gurun, Kedah.

In her new position, based in Kuala Lumpur, Noël will report Carlos Gomes, Executive Vice President, China & Southeast Asia, and execute PSA Group’s development in Southeast Asia, as part of the company's larger ‘Push to Pass’ plan, first announced in 2016. Laurence Noël joined Group PSA in 1995. After holding various positions in Powertrain Projects and Programmes, she took charge of Powertrain, Platform and Module Programmes in 2014.

The NAM joint venture will oversee the production and marketing of Peugeot, Citroën, and DS Automobiles vehicles in Malaysia and other ASEAN markets.

The first vehicles to be produced locally will be the Peugeot 3008 in 2018, followed by the Citroen C5 Aircross SUV in 2019.

The Naza Automotive Manufacturing (NAM) plant in Gurun, Kedah has been in operation since 2004, has a workforce of close to 450 people, and boasts a 50,000 vehicle per year production capacity.
